TAG Heuer and New Balance have joined forces to create a purpose-driven duo: the TAG Heuer Connected Calibre E5 40 mm x New Balance Edition smartwatch and the FuelCell SuperComp Elite v5 running shoe. Aimed at athletes who train with intention, this special-edition pairing underscores a shared obsession with precision, performance and pushing boundaries.
The TAG Heuer Connected Calibre E5 40 mm x New Balance Edition houses the brand’s fifth-generation Calibre E5 movement and a proprietary in-house OS for an intuitive, responsive interface. Its black DLC–coated Grade-2 titanium case is sandblasted for lightweight durability, while a novel 0–100 scale on the dial syncs directly with app-based training metrics. “From the pinnacle design of our FuelCell SuperComp Elite 5 to the cutting-edge intelligence of TAG Heuer’s Connected Calibre E5, we’re creating instruments that elevate athletes and celebrate the art of innovation,” notes Chris Davis, Global Brand President & CMO of New Balance.
Color and material choices further unite these performance icons. A deep violet hue – inspired by English Purple – and vibrant green accents mirror the co-branded New Balance shoe, while an engraved New Balance logo on the watch’s sapphire caseback cements the precision partnership. TAG Heuer’s patented Cushion Comfort System strap combines a flexible rubber base with high-tech textile from the shoe’s inlay, delivering comfort and durability. Each watch, priced at 1,950 CHF (approx. $2,447 USD) also includes a second, New Balance-embroidered strap for a secure fit during intense workouts.
Built for race day, the $270 USD FuelCell SuperComp Elite v5 features an ultralight design with a carbon-fiber plate, PEBA midsole for explosive energy return and an 8 mm heel-to-toe drop. Engineered mesh uppers and a durable rubber outsole ensure breathability and traction when every second counts. “Our collaboration with New Balance felt like a natural alignment,” adds George Ciz, TAG Heuer’s CMO. “We’ve combined cutting-edge watch technology with the highest-performing running shoes to inspire people to push their limits—on the track, the road or in life.” Both items arrive in co-branded packaging with custom sockliners and will be released in limited quantities worldwide.
